Lithium: The Metal of the Future

Lithium has long been used in various industries, from heat-resistant glass to pharmaceuticals. However, its role in the manufacture of rechargeable batteries, particularly for electric vehicles (EVs), has brought lithium into the spotlight. As the demand for EVs skyrockets, so does the need for lithium, with global demand expected to increase from 500,000 tonnes in 2021 to 4 million tonnes by 2030. This massive growth reflects the world’s transition toward greener energy solutions, a movement in which Rotomyne plays a central role.

 

Rotomyne’s Approach to Lithium Extraction

The company operates six hard rock mines and three traditional brine mines across six countries, employing a combination of methods to extract lithium. While traditional brine mining is cheaper, it requires a staggering 500,000 liters of water to process one tonne of lithium, which pose environmental risks, particularly in water-scarce regions. Further, hard rock mining carries the highest CO2 emmissions.

Rotomyne can mitigate these risks by investing in Direct Lithium Extraction (DLE), an environmentally friendly alternative that uses significantly less water and eliminates the destructive impact of evaporation ponds. However, the company has yet to transition to the DLE method.
